powered by simpleCommunicator - 2.0.61     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/ PHP, Perl, Python [игнор отключен] [закрыт для гостей] / PHP Script
25 сообщений из 27, страница 1 из 2
PHP Script
    #33520297
Фотография Olympico
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Товарищи помогите разобраться

автор
<?
session_start();

$dbserver="localhost"; //mysql server to connect to
$dbuser="user"; //mysql username
$dbpass="pass"; //mysql password
$dbname="dbname"; //myswl database name
$realm="Name"; //name of the protected area

$dbase=mysql_pconnect($dbserver, $dbuser, $dbpass);
mysql_select_db($dbname);

if(!isset($nonce))
{
$nonce=base64_encode("$REMOTE_ADDR:".time().":".uniqid(rand(),1));
session_register("nonce");
echo "new nonce created<BR>";
}

$headers .= 'WWW-Authenticate: Digest realm="'.$realm.'", algorithm=MD5, qop="auth-int", nonce="'.$nonce.'"';
$headers .= "\r\n";
$headers .= "HTTP/1.0 401 Unauthorized\r\n";

//process the headers
$header = apache_request_headers();

if(isset($header[Authorization]))
{
$auth_temp=explode(", ", $header[Authorization]);

foreach($auth_temp as $key=>$value)
{
$temp=explode("=", $value);
$auth_vars[$temp[0]]=str_replace("\"", "", $temp[1]);
$nonce_vars=explode(":", base64_decode($nonce));
}
$user=$auth_vars["Digest username"];
$sql="SELECT * FROM md5_auth WHERE username = '$user'";
$result=mysql_query($sql, $dbase) or die(mysql_error());
$num=mysql_num_rows($result);
$md5data=mysql_fetch_array($result);

$pass=$md5data[2];
$user_digest=md5("$user:$realm:$pass");
$method_digest=md5("$REQUEST_METHOD:$REQUEST_URI");
//done with the headers


//digest
if(isset($auth_vars[cnonce]))
{
$digest=md5("$user_digest:$nonce:$auth_vars[nc]:$auth_vars[cnonce]:$auth_vars[qop]:$method_digest");
}
else
{
$digest=md5("$user_digest:$nonce:$method_digest");
}
//end of digest
}
else
{
header($headers);
exit;
}

if($auth_vars[nonce] != $nonce || $auth_vars[response] != $digest || $nonce_vars[0] != $REMOTE_ADDR)
{
header("$headers");
unset($nonce);
echo "401 Unauthorized";
exit;
}
?>


Ну очень прошу...не як ради халявы, а як шобы размудреть
...
Рейтинг: 0 / 0
PHP Script
    #33521683
Фотография ©Felix
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
а в чем вопрос?
_______________
Felix
...
Рейтинг: 0 / 0
PHP Script
    #33522108
Фотография 4m@t!c
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Olympico, когда вы уже научитесь осмысленно называть топики?
----------------------------------------
Артисты не приехали, приехали цыгане
...
Рейтинг: 0 / 0
PHP Script
    #33522649
Фотография Olympico
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
4m@t!cOlympico, когда вы уже научитесь осмысленно называть топики?
----------------------------------------
Артисты не приехали, приехали цыгане

Так точно генерал-старший прапорщик, виноват исправлюсь.

Не просто не могу разобраться, как организовать защиту сайта и отдельных страниц...Вот и перебераю разные скрипты на эту тему...
...
Рейтинг: 0 / 0
PHP Script
    #33522657
DocAl
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
И чем же вам помочь?
...
Рейтинг: 0 / 0
PHP Script
    #33522706
Фотография Olympico
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Ну хотябы просто прокаментировать этот скрипт, и чего не хватает для его работы...впринципе коментария хватит
...
Рейтинг: 0 / 0
PHP Script
    #33522973
Фотография Robert Tappan Moris
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
=)
У меня есть движок сайта, в 5-ти файлах - пол мега кода и 2 строчки комментариев.
Никто не хочеть расставить там комментарии?
...
Рейтинг: 0 / 0
PHP Script
    #33522977
Фотография Black
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Robert Tappan Moris=)
У меня есть движок сайта, в 5-ти файлах - пол мега кода и 2 строчки комментариев.
Никто не хочеть расставить там комментарии?
извольте
...
Рейтинг: 0 / 0
PHP Script
    #33522998
Фотография 4m@t!c
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Навскидку. В чем глубокий смысл старотовать сессию в первой же строке? Дальше уже не стал смотреть.

P.S. Я - старлей.
----------------------------------------
Артисты не приехали, приехали цыгане
...
Рейтинг: 0 / 0
PHP Script
    #33523003
Фотография Olympico
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Все смеетесь бэтманы...
...
Рейтинг: 0 / 0
PHP Script
    #33523005
Фотография Olympico
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Robert Tappan Moris=)
У меня есть движок сайта, в 5-ти файлах - пол мега кода и 2 строчки комментариев.
Никто не хочеть расставить там комментарии?

С какого дня ты таким умным стал...праздноречивый конь?
...
Рейтинг: 0 / 0
PHP Script
    #33523020
DocAl
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Вот давайте вы, всё же, сами на этот скрипт посмотрите, посмотрите в документацию, и когда будет непонятно что-то конкретное, что делается в строке номер эн, тогда и будете спрашивать?
Пока это выглядит откровенной ленью разбираться самостоятельно.
...
Рейтинг: 0 / 0
PHP Script
    #33523034
Фотография Olympico
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
А можно узнать хотябы роль этого скрипта?
...
Рейтинг: 0 / 0
PHP Script
    #33523210
*
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
*
Гость
OlympicoА можно узнать хотябы роль этого скрипта?Можно. К примеру, задав этот вопрос её автору.
...
Рейтинг: 0 / 0
PHP Script
    #33523246
Фотография Olympico
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
* OlympicoА можно узнать хотябы роль этого скрипта?Можно. К примеру, задав этот вопрос её автору.

Нивидимка хорош меня посылать к авторам...форум ведь сделан в общеобразовательных целях?

Вот я и хочу повысить свой IP путем разборки этого скрипта...так как там много нейзвесных мне конструкций и функций...

А узнав назначения я попробую разобрать алгоритм его работы...
...
Рейтинг: 0 / 0
PHP Script
    #33523297
*
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
*
Гость
OlympicoНивидимка хорош меня посылать к авторам...форум ведь сделан в общеобразовательных целях? phpclub.ru/faq/WhyForum Вот я и хочу повысить свой IP путем разборки этого скрипта...так как там много нейзвесных мне конструкций и функций...
А узнав назначения я попробую разобрать алгоритм его работы... phpclub.ru/faq/ReadManual
...
Рейтинг: 0 / 0
PHP Script
    #33523371
Фотография Olympico
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
* OlympicoНивидимка хорош меня посылать к авторам...форум ведь сделан в общеобразовательных целях? phpclub.ru/faq/WhyForum Вот я и хочу повысить свой IP путем разборки этого скрипта...так как там много нейзвесных мне конструкций и функций...
А узнав назначения я попробую разобрать алгоритм его работы... phpclub.ru/faq/ReadManual

)))))))))))))))))))))(
...
Рейтинг: 0 / 0
PHP Script
    #33523419
DocAl
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Olympico
Вот я и хочу повысить свой IP путем разборки этого скрипта...так как там много нейзвесных мне конструкций и функций...

Угу, и выпрямить чакры...

Блин! Ну хотите -- так повышайте?!
Читайте в документацию о неизвестных вам конструкциях и функциях.
Хотя, надо сказать, этот скрипт вряд ли стоит брать как образец для подражания.
...
Рейтинг: 0 / 0
PHP Script
    #33523460
Фотография Olympico
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Я и не собираюсь обезьяничать...
...
Рейтинг: 0 / 0
PHP Script
    #33523485
Фотография Robert Tappan Moris
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Olympico, на мой взгляд именно этим вы и занимаетесь.

P.S. на счет дня когда "таким умным стал" история умалчивает, и думаю это мало кого должно интересовать.
...
Рейтинг: 0 / 0
PHP Script
    #33523530
Фотография Olympico
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Robert Tappan MorisOlympico, на мой взгляд именно этим вы и занимаетесь.

P.S. на счет дня когда "таким умным стал" история умалчивает, и думаю это мало кого должно интересовать.

Ругаться не будем, а то еще умнее можете стать...
Конь, говорящий мега-стручками))))
По моему мнению именно вы уважаемый и произошли от обезьяны.
...
Рейтинг: 0 / 0
PHP Script
    #33523533
DocAl
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Olympico, вы не могли бы рассказать нам, в каких новых конструкциях и функциях вы успели разобраться за последние 6-7 часов?
...
Рейтинг: 0 / 0
PHP Script
    #33523611
Фотография Olympico
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
DocAlOlympico, вы не могли бы рассказать нам, в каких новых конструкциях и функциях вы успели разобраться за последние 6-7 часов?

DocAl, я извеняюсь с того момента когда этот разговор обрел вид хамства...я занялся другим вопросом, ставлю на apache jsp
...
Рейтинг: 0 / 0
PHP Script
    #33523722
*
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
*
Гость
DocAlOlympico, вы не могли бы рассказать нам, в каких новых конструкциях и функциях вы успели разобраться за последние 6-7 часов?Разве не очевидно, что его не интересует его проблема? Он ждёт, когда её за него решат, попутно рассуждая на отвлечённые от его проблемы темы. В частности - хамя.
...
Рейтинг: 0 / 0
PHP Script
    #33523731
Фотография Olympico
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
* DocAlOlympico, вы не могли бы рассказать нам, в каких новых конструкциях и функциях вы успели разобраться за последние 6-7 часов?Разве не очевидно, что его не интересует его проблема? Он ждёт, когда её за него решат, попутно рассуждая на отвлечённые от его проблемы темы. В частности - хамя.

Парни вам ни кажется следующая картина:

Толпа народа собралась вокруг когото и рассуждают между собой, а умный ли он, а может нет,а вдруг он умнее нас, а давайте проверим, потрогаем, подергаем...Ааааах он еще и хамит, вы посмотрите какой бестыдник))) И кто-то самый умный из них: - Ой пойдемте отсюда мальчики, нам здесь не место...
...
Рейтинг: 0 / 0
25 сообщений из 27, страница 1 из 2
Форумы / PHP, Perl, Python [игнор отключен] [закрыт для гостей] / PHP Script
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]